DDJohnson,

I do highly recommend that you give AWC a try. It is a good daily tool to optimize and keep your computer running fast and smooth with little effort.

It is NOT an anti virus program, but it does scan for spyware and blocks a lot of bad things from coming in to your computer- a wonderfull program!

There are good free antivirus and spyware programs out there too. Also, if your Norton was a security suite you will need a firewall to replace the one in Norton. If you do remove the Norton, first go to thier website and find the appropriate removal tool. Just uninstalling usually doesn't get it all out and can cause you problems in the registry (have seen it many times with both the N & M products). Download and save the cleanup tool. Run it after you run the uninstaller.

Of the ones I have tried (including N & M) I have had the best results with Free AVG anti-virus, free Zone Alarm Firewall, and free Adaware 2007 spyware remover-(very important-use only one firewall & one antivirus, but don't rely on one program to remove all spyware & adware, each gets different things!). This combination along with AWC has given me the best trouble free computer I ever had! ( I do use AWC Pro, but go ahead & try Personal, you will probably upgrade to Pro-you'll love it.)

Suggestion for additional feature: Include System File Checker

 

For some reason Microsoft has chosen not to include a "Repair" utility for Windows Vista (or any of the other vesions for that matter) similar to the repair function of (e.g.) Microsoft Office. :cry:

 

I guess this will be difficult for IObit to replicate (maybe MS found it too difficult.....) but I'm sure there are some things that you could do such as restoring some of the defaults used by MS during the installation. :? For example, my printer now only prints after I re-boot and I'm sure it was my fault in playing around with some of the settings trying to make Vista faster (before I found this wonderful program). :-D

 

Before running the option to "restore defaults" perhaps you could display a list of the things you are able to reset and people could tick (or untick) those they want resetting.

 

Another option you might consider is to offer the choice of running the System File Checker (sfc /scannow.....) to replace any system files missing or damaged. Of course this might be tricky for people who do not have their installation disk but it could be a useful option.
